Securing Your Taxi at Sutton Airport
Several methods can be employed to arrange taxi services for Sutton Airport:
- Pre-booking: This is by far the most recommended approach. By booking your taxi in advance, you ensure availability, can often secure a better rate, and know exactly who will be picking you up. Many local taxi companies allow you to book online through their websites or via their dedicated apps. When booking, clearly state your flight details (arrival or departure), the number of passengers, and any special requirements (e.g., luggage space, child seats).
- On-site Taxi Ranks: While not always guaranteed at smaller airports, some do maintain official taxi ranks where licensed taxis wait for passengers. It's advisable to check the Sutton Airport's official website or information leaflets for details on whether a dedicated taxi rank is available and how it operates. If a rank is present, ensure you are using a fully licensed vehicle.
- Airport Information Desks: Upon arrival, if you haven't pre-booked, you might be able to get assistance from an airport information desk. They may have contact numbers for local taxi firms or be able to help you hail a licensed cab.
- Ride-Sharing Apps: Depending on the airport's location and the prevalence of services like Uber or Bolt in the area, these apps can be a convenient option. Check the app's coverage for Sutton and the surrounding areas to see if drivers are readily available. Ensure you are aware of designated pick-up zones for these services.
What Makes a Good Airport Taxi Service?
When choosing a taxi service for your airport transfer, several factors contribute to a positive experience:
- Reliability: Punctuality is non-negotiable. Your taxi must arrive on time, whether picking you up for a flight or dropping you off after arrival.
- Licensing and Insurance: Always opt for licensed taxis and private hire vehicles. This ensures they meet safety standards and are properly insured. Unlicensed operators can pose significant risks.
- Professional Drivers: Drivers should be knowledgeable about local routes, courteous, and professional. For airport transfers, they should also be aware of traffic patterns and potential delays.
- Vehicle Condition: The vehicle should be clean, comfortable, and well-maintained, with adequate space for your luggage.
- Transparent Pricing: Understand the fare structure beforehand. Reputable companies will offer clear quotes, especially for pre-booked airport journeys, often with fixed rates. Avoid services that seem vague about pricing.
Comparing Taxi and Private Hire Options
It's useful to understand the distinction between traditional taxis and private hire vehicles (PHVs), often referred to as minicabs in some parts of the UK.
| Feature | Traditional Taxi (Hackney Carriage) | Private Hire Vehicle (PHV/Minicab) |
|---|---|---|
| Booking Method | Can be hailed on the street, hired from a taxi rank, or booked in advance. | Must be pre-booked. Cannot be hailed on the street. |
| Identification | Typically black (though colours vary by region), have a roof sign indicating they are for hire, and a taximeter. | Various colours and designs, usually no roof sign, and may not have a visible taximeter (fares are agreed in advance). |
| Regulation | Licensed by local authorities, drivers undergo background checks and knowledge tests. | Licensed by local authorities, drivers undergo background checks. |
| Fare Calculation | Calculated by a taximeter based on distance and time. | Fare is agreed at the time of booking. |
Both types of services are regulated and can be suitable for airport transfers. The choice often comes down to personal preference and availability.
